Valorisation Centre 1 The Valorisation Centre supports, stimulates and facilitates scientists and faculties in the valorisation of its knowledge by means of: Cooperation with companies Protection of Intellectual Property Business development, spin-offs Lifelong learning Acquisition of external funding (strategy, training, advice, management)

Valorisation Centre 2 EU funding Benefits: Team up with European scientists, building networks Visibility in Brussels Image building, branding of TU Delft’s name Wide range of complementary funding programs Advantageous funding characteristics

Valorisation Centre 3 Strategy Implementation EU VAL. CENTRE Directly, through Committees or at Member state level Rules & regulations for Participation and funding TU DELFT

Valorisation Centre 4 Effective strategies Strategic level financial level; first identify your targets: what are your financial sources now, and where will you be in 5 years? scientific level: what are your scientific competencies, can you identify a few areas in which you want you excel on a EU level? Also, build your competencies, first as partner than as applicant/coordinator, or first individual grants, than multipartner research grants Appoint strategic staff and train them to get to know Brussels: Policy documents – also for EuroMed region Framework documents, rules of participation Lobbying groups in Brussels Management information systems (nr of bids, nr of grants, etc)

Valorisation Centre 5 Effective support structure Implementation level Define the right support structure for legal, financial and managerial support for those scientists that are busy acquiring EU funding. Centralised or decentralised? What kind of staff needed? Legal, financial and managerial Training of staff, invest! Financial accountancy system in place, FP proof?

Valorisation Centre 6 Centralized: Board & Deansstrategic choices based on MIS Central services: Finance & Control (F&C)financial accountancy system, time registration, direct/indirect cost Legal Affairs (BJO)EU grant agreements, consortium agreements, IP protection Policy & Strategy (BMO)MIS De-centralized: Faculty: Faculty SecretariesImplementation of EU programs in the faculty Technology Transfer Officers (TTO)Scout for relevant calls Contract managersfirst advisor for scientists (legal & financial info Project Administratorsdraw up declarations, arrange for auditing Department Dep. Secretarieshelping contract managers in large faculties Overview EU-support structure TU Delft Valorisation centre- project management

Valorisation Centre 8 Building up experience and capacities Junior staff can be steered to individual scholarships 1-5 years, than network to become partner another 5 years Senior staff should network to become partner, after 10 years- coordinatorships and ERC.

Valorisation Centre 9 Example of support of Valorisation Centre in case of a specific FP7 project ACQUISITION: Advice to scientist on the FP program, work programs, call info, laise with NCP, Brussels Advice on consortium building Advice on writing a competative proposal Advice on budgeting Registration of proposal, Part A and B submitted CONTRACT NEGOTIATION: Negotiation meeting, NEF, Grant agreement(s) Consortium agreements IMPLEMENTATION (project management) PROVIDE TRAINING to scientists and support staff
